metal artist Belle Cole, 33, of Cowbridge Sawmill, Timberscombe, who welds everything from motorbikes to flowers and environmental art sculptures, will make her television debut on Tuesday (January 18) in a programme featuring people involved in the world of scrap metal.
’Scrap Kings’ will be aired at 9pm on Quest, Freeview channel 12/Freesat channel 167. It is already available on the Discovery+ channel, via subscription.
Belle and her son Jonty, five, will appear in an episode about her artwork and a sculpture she made for Devon Sculpture Park.
Nature, flowers and the Exmoor environment are Belle’s inspiration. She became a welder after discovering a passion for stainless steel, did an engineering diploma at Bridgwater College, and set up her own business as a metal artist and sculptor in 2018.

It shows her describing what she does, and finishing off the motorbike she was working on.
The film crew then followed her down to Devon Sculpture Park, where the motorbike was unveiled. It and some of her metal poppies are part of an exhibition there called Relics of a Fossil Fuelled Past.
"My son Jonty is also in the programme, explaining about the bike, and it’s a really lovely moment for me," said Belle.
"With only three weeks to work on the bike part-time before filming began, everything became very pressurised.
"Everyone was lovely and supportive and I was able to do what was needed," she said. "It’s been a really interesting experience. It’s funny to see yourself on the screen, I was mortified at first, but I enjoyed it."
